Home
last modified time | relevance | path

Searched refs:conn_sring (Results 1 – 2 of 2) sorted by relevance

/openbmc/qemu/hw/usb/
H A Dxen-usb.c107 void *conn_sring; member
595 if (!usbif->conn_sring) { in usbback_hotplug_notify()
847 if (usbif->conn_sring) { in usbback_disconnect()
848 xen_be_unmap_grant_ref(xendev, usbif->conn_sring, usbif->conn_ring_ref); in usbback_disconnect()
849 usbif->conn_sring = NULL; in usbback_disconnect()
865 struct usbif_conn_sring *conn_sring; in usbback_connect() local
893 usbif->conn_sring = xen_be_map_grant_ref(xendev, conn_ring_ref, in usbback_connect()
895 if (!usbif->urb_sring || !usbif->conn_sring) { in usbback_connect()
904 conn_sring = usbif->conn_sring; in usbback_connect()
906 BACK_RING_INIT(&usbif->conn_ring, conn_sring, XEN_PAGE_SIZE); in usbback_connect()
/openbmc/linux/drivers/usb/host/
H A Dxen-hcd.c1111 struct xenusb_conn_sring *conn_sring; in xenhcd_setup_rings() local
1124 (void **)&conn_sring, 1, &info->conn_ring_ref); in xenhcd_setup_rings()
1129 XEN_FRONT_RING_INIT(&info->conn_ring, conn_sring, PAGE_SIZE); in xenhcd_setup_rings()